United States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it MISCELLANEOUS DOCKET NO. 914 IN RE NINTENDO CO.. LTD. and NINTENDO OF AMERICA INC., ‘ Petitioners.

On Petition for Writ of Mandamus to the United States District Court for the Eastern District of Texas, case no. 6:08-cv-429, Judge Leonard Davis.

ON PETITION FOR WRIT OF MANDAMUS Before RADER, Circuit Judge.

0 R D E R Nintendo Co., Ltd. and Nintendo of America Inc. move for leave to file a reply in support of their petition for a writ of mandamus .

Upon consideration thereof, IT IS ORDERED THAT: The motion is granted.
